How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 19099?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 19099 Studio Apartments | $1,805 | $647 | $9,999 |
| 19099 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,345 | $600 | $15,050 |
| 19099 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,037 | $725 | $14,060 |
| 19099 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,573 | $640 | $16,075 |
| 19099 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,427 | $585 | $24,995 |
| 19099 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,810 | $1,249 | $5,000 |
| 19099 6 Bedroom Apartments | $1,645 | $525 | $4,495 |
